9:00 AM ET The New York Giants stuck with Eli Manning as their starting quarterback out of the bye week. He responded with his first three-touchdown effort of the season. Manning finished 19-of-31 passing for 188 yards in the 27-23 victory over the San Francisco 49ers on Monday night. He led a game-winning touchdown drive

Nov 16, 2018 ESPNcricinfo staff Batting allrounder Devika Vaidya, who bowls legspin, has been named as replacement for the injured quick-bowling allrounder Pooja Vastrakar in India’s World T20 squad after the latter was ruled out of the tournament due to a knee injury sustained during India’s warm-up game on November 4 against West Indies.
